Ekubo V3 (Ethereum)
Ekubo V3 (Ethereum) is a [decentralized finance](/wiki/decentralized_finance) (DeFi) protocol designed to enhance the functionality and efficiency of Ethereum-based applications. It builds upon previous versions by introducing new features and optimizations. As of October 2023, Ekubo V3 aims to improve liquidity provision, reduce transaction costs, and enhance user experience within the Ethereum ecosystem. How it works
Ekubo V3 operates through a series of smart contracts, which are self-executing contracts with the terms of the agreement directly written into code. These smart contracts automate transactions and ensure that they are executed only when certain conditions are met. Ekubo V3's smart contracts are designed to be more efficient, reducing the computational resources required to execute transactions, which in turn lowers gas fees.
Key Features
- Optimized Liquidity Pools: Ekubo V3 introduces improved algorithms for managing liquidity pools, which are collections of funds used to facilitate trading on decentralized exchanges. These algorithms aim to provide better price stability and reduce slippage, which is the difference between the expected price of a trade and the actual price.
- Gas Fee Reduction: By optimizing the underlying code and transaction processes, Ekubo V3 reduces the gas fees associated with Ethereum transactions. Gas fees are payments made by users to compensate for the computational energy required to process and validate transactions on the Ethereum network.
- User Interface Enhancements: The protocol includes a more intuitive user interface, making it easier for users to interact with the platform and manage their assets.

Relationship to USDT
USDT, or Tether, is a stablecoin pegged to the value of the US dollar. It is widely used in the cryptocurrency market to provide stability and facilitate trading. Ekubo V3 interacts with USDT in several ways:
- Liquidity Provision: USDT is often used as a base currency in liquidity pools, allowing users to trade between USDT and other cryptocurrencies. Ekubo V3's optimized liquidity pools enhance the efficiency of these trades.
- Stablecoin Transactions: By reducing gas fees, Ekubo V3 makes it more cost-effective to transact with stablecoins like USDT on the Ethereum network.
- Collateral for Loans: Users can use USDT as collateral in lending and borrowing applications within the Ekubo V3 ecosystem, providing a stable asset against which to borrow other cryptocurrencies.
